Can’t beat ‘em? Join ‘em. Celsius Holdings is making power moves in the energy drink space, announcing plans to acquire fast-growing competitor Alani Nu for a whopping $1.8 billion.
Why this makes perfect sense: While both brands share a health-conscious audience, they target different demographics. Celsius built its empire with a gender-neutral audience through fitness associations, while Alani Nu has specifically targeted women with innovative flavors and aspirational influencer marketing (think: Addison Rae, Kim Kardashian), building a social following that's 92% female.
While Celsius (the #3 energy brand in the US) grew volume by 38% through Q3 2024, Alani Nu (currently #5) saw volume increase by a staggering 62.7% during the same period.
Market consolidation continues: This isn't the first big move in the energy and wellness space recently. Nutrabolt (maker of C4 Energy) invested $90 million for a 20% stake in Bloom Nutrition, Keurig Dr Pepper acquired GHOST for approximately $1 billion (60% stake), and just last month, Safety Shot acquired Yerbaé brands.
As traditional energy drink leaders Monster Energy and Red Bull see their volumes declining (down 1.9% and 3.8% respectively in the first three quarters of 2024), these strategic acquisitions position newer, BFY brands to potentially reshape the energy drink landscape.

Sparkling water? Out. Better-for-you soda? In. Spindrift, the massive flavored sparkling water brand, is jumping into the booming healthier soda market with a new line of sodas in nostalgic 90s flavors, like Orange Cream Float, Strawberry Shortcake, and Shirley Temple.🥤
After being acquired by Gryphon Investors for $650M in late 2024, this is Spindrift's first major move to capitalize on their investment.
While the timing of this feels almost too on-the-nose (following Olipop's recent $1.85B valuation and Poppi’s Super Bowl stardom), Spindrift ~isn’t like the other girls~, entering soda with built-in trust and the distribution to match.
They're positioning with 20% not-from-concentrate juice, zero added sugar (or stevia), and taking direct shots at competitors with statements like "no added distractions like prebiotics that may or may not work." 👀

Carving a new David. In a moderately controversial change, the (equal parts successful and polarizing) David protein bar brand updated its ingredient profile to improve taste, texture, and shelf stability while maintaining the core nutrition of 28g protein, 150 calories, and 0g sugar.
Here’s what they did: They reduced allulose (which caused Maillard browning and hardness over time) and replaced it with maltitol, eliminating polydextrose to prevent hardening. Stevia and monk fruit were swapped for sucralose and acesulfame potassium, and natural and artificial flavors were used to create more intense, dessert-inspired flavors without increasing caloric impact.
Coke enters the prebiotic chat. Coke is launching a new line of prebiotic sodas called Simply Pop under the Simply juice name, featuring five fruit-forward flavors made with 6 grams of prebiotic fiber and no added sugar.

Gardening in a bottle. BRĒZ, a rapidly growing cannabis beverage brand has launched its latest innovation, BRĒZ Spirit, with a limited 1,000 bottles. BRĒZ launched in 2023 and has grown quickly, pushing $30M in revenue across DTC and ~2,000 stores.
And the trends agree: The cannabis beverage category writ large is growing significantly ($1.83 billion in 2023, projected to skyrocket to $81 billion by 2032), as consumers move away from alcohol and THC products become legalized—or at least commercialized.
Liquor stores now have dedicated THC sections for the onslaught of brands entering the space. Major retailers like Total Wine & More are seeing strong growth and investing heavily in the space. Distribution is expanding rapidly through new channels - DoorDash just launched THC/CBD product delivery in legal markets.

Buy with Prime grows. Adidas is joining Amazon's Buy with Prime program, bringing the service to adidas.com and the adidas app. This integration will give Prime members access to fast delivery and easy returns when shopping directly on Adidas platforms. The new feature will launch in Spring 2025.
Online to offline. Lucky has partnered with Ulta Beauty to enhance the beauty shopping experience by connecting DTC websites with Ulta's in-store inventory in real-time. This collaboration allows customers to check product availability at nearby Ulta locations, facilitating same-day pickup or delivery.
Lucky already partners with retailers like Sephora, Best Buy, CVS, and Nordstrom!

Welcome to the new generation of retail. IKEA plans to open eight new format stores in 2025 in the US. Seven of these will be Plan & order points with Pick-up. The eighth location will be a Pick-up point in Santa Monica.
Plan & order points with Pick-up are smaller format stores where customers can plan and order home furnishing solutions like kitchens, bathrooms, and closet storage systems with IKEA staff, and pick up their purchases at their convenience.
A sad day for the DIYers. Joann is set to close all ~800 stores nationwide after 82 years in business, following a bankruptcy filing and a sale process.
Maybe not “forever” after all…Forever 21 is set to close at least 200 of its 350 stores as it prepares for a potential second bankruptcy, following increased competition in the fast fashion sector. The company aims to find a buyer for its remaining U.S. stores, or face liquidation if unsuccessful.

Plant-based is still cooking. Blackbird Foods, a New York-based producer of vegan pizzas and wings, has been acquired by Ahimsa Companies. Ahimsa has previously acquired other leading plant-based food brands Wicked Kitchen and Simulate.
We hope it stays weird. Aura Bora, a San Francisco-based sparkling water brand, has been acquired by the New York-based private-equity firm Next in Natural for an undisclosed amount.
Despite its successful growth and cult-like following, the challenging fundraising environment made it difficult for Aura Bora to secure further investment, prompting the decision to sell. The company's CEO, Paul Voge, plans to remain with the brand to ensure a smooth transition into its new ownership.
Love me some bourbon. Brother's Bond Bourbon, a Plano-based whiskey brand founded by Ian Somerhalder and Paul Wesley, has secured $7.5 million in funding to expand its presence in the U.S. and international markets.
Ian is also the founder of the fast growing supplement brand The Absorption Company.
The NA bev everyone should be talking about. Constellation Brands has taken a minority stake in Hiyo, a non-alcoholic beverage brand that offers a social tonic crafted with adaptogens and botanicals. This partnership aims to expand Constellation's non-alcoholic portfolio and meet the growing consumer demand.
Pet is booming! Oh Norman!, a pet wellness brand co-founded by Katie Hunt and Kaley Cuoco, has secured $200,000 in funding from Mars Petcare through the Leap Venture Studio & Academy accelerator program.
